What affects the price

Remodeling your pool is a custom project, so final costs depend heavily on the specific upgrades you select. Replacing simple pool tiles or updating your plaster is generally more affordable than installing entirely new decking, lighting systems, or automation features. The physical size of your pool and the current condition of the plumbing underneath also play a major role in the total bill. If we need to address structural cracks or upgrade aging equipment, you will see the project cost shift accordingly. Exact pricing confirmed free on the call.

What's the optimal time of year for pool resurfacing in Chicago?

The optimal time of year for pool resurfacing in Chicago is typically during the spring or fall shoulder seasons. These periods offer moderate temperatures that are ideal for the proper curing of new pool surfaces, whether it's plaster or aggregate. Avoiding the extreme heat of summer and the freezing temperatures of winter is crucial for optimal results. The licensed pros we work with can schedule your project during these windows to ensure the best possible outcome. Early spring or late fall can also be viable, depending on weather patterns.
